Explains what obsessive-compulsive disorder is, how it affects people and what can be done to help people overcome it.
This informative and supportive series explores in detail some common mental health issues affecting the lives of children today.
Working to tackle and destigmatise mental health issues, these creative and factual titles explore conditions such as ADHD, OCD, anxiety and depression. Readers can learn about causes, symptoms and practical coping strategies including mindfulness, talking therapies and when to ask for professional help.
We look at how to look after our own mental health, and support others around you. Developed with support from leading children's mental health professionals and key workers.
